Your Next Challenge

As an Operations Specialist with us, you will be a key player in ensuring the operation and driving the development of our high-tech, newly built paper machine – always with safety, quality, and the environment as the highest priority. In this role, you take responsibility and create improvements that contribute to a sustainable future and factory.

In this dynamic role, you will support both the group manager and the operators in daily operations. You will also have close dialogue and collaboration with the maintenance department to create a more efficient flow in our production together. You will handle urgent faults, plan and coordinate the start and stop of the facility, as well as carry out maintenance stops.

This role suits you who enjoy working closely with people and processes. Here you contribute with technical expertise, systematically develop methods and routines, and initiate and drive improvement projects that strengthen the work environment, operational economy, and quality. You will also perform risk analyses and work to ensure safe and efficient production.
